The Role

Reporting into senior production leadership, you'll take responsibility for the day‑to‑day management of field production, seasonal labour and crop delivery.

The operation has strong foundations, existing infrastructure and clear scope for growth. With the right person in post, field production has the potential to increase significantly over the coming years.

Key responsibilities include:

  • Managing field and nursery operations through the full production cycle
  • Sowing, transplanting and crop husbandry
  • Tractor driving and operation of agricultural machinery
  • Organising lifting, picking and preparation of stock to specification
  • Supervising seasonal and agency labour at peak periods
  • Making day‑to‑day operational decisions
  • Identifying opportunities to improve efficiency and increase output
  • Ensuring safe working practices at all times

The role follows a seasonal rhythm, with heavier sowing and tractor work in spring, crop maintenance through summer, and lifting during the winter period.

The Person

This role would suit someone who enjoys autonomy, practical responsibility and is comfortable working both independently and as part of a wider team.

You'll have:

  • Experience working in a field‑based or production horticulture/agriculture environment
  • Some experience managing or supervising people (this doesn't need to be extensive - they're happy to train and support).
  • Tractor driving experience
  • PA1 / PA2 / PA6 would be ideal, though training can be provided
